HQ-PPEK/PC共混物的相容性与流变性
摘要:
将特种工程塑料进行共混改性优化其性能,是开发高新工程材料最有效的方法之一[1~3].聚合物共混物的相容性和流变性能往往决定了材料的各种使用性能以及加工工艺,所以研究聚合物共混物的相容性和流变性能具有极其重要的意义.HQ-PPEK是本课题组以含二氮杂萘酮结构的类双酚单体(DHPZ)、对苯二酚(摩尔比1:1)和4,4'-二氟二苯酮进行三元共聚而得到的新型聚芳醚酮,它综合了PPEK(Tg=263℃)和PEEK(Tg=144℃)的多种优点:溶解性好,耐温等级高,易于加工流动[4].双酚A型聚碳酸酯(PC)是一种综合性能优良的工程塑料.本文主要探讨HQ-PPEK/PC共混物的相容性和流变性能.

Miscibility and Rheological Properties of HQ-PPEK/PC Blends
Abstract:
The blends of HQ-PPEK, prepared by polymerization of 4-(4-hydroxyphenyl)-1-phthalazone(DHPZ) and hydroquinone(HQ)(1:1 molar ratio) with 4,4'-diflourodiphenylketone and polycarbonate(PC) through coprecipitation in chloroform solution. The miscibility of the blends was characterized by ternary-solution methods and DSC. The results indicated that the blends were immiscible or partially miscible. The rheological properties of the blends were studied by capillary rheometer. The results show that the melt blends are psedoplastic fluids, the die swelling ratios decrease and the non-Newtonian index increases with increase in the weight content of PC in the blends and the blends viscosity curves negatively does not follow the single additivity rule.
